Roulette has long been a staple in the landscape of gambling, dating back to 18th-century France. The game comprises a spinning wheel, a small ball, and a betting table, where players place their wagers on numbers and colors. The core mechanics have remained unchanged, even as the game transitioned onto digital platforms. One of the key aspects that make online roulette potentially unaffected by technological advances is the game’s inherent randomness and the house edge. Roulette is a game of chance where each spin is governed by random outcomes. Modern technology has, in many ways, performed a valuable service by ensuring that these random outcomes remain unpredictable; certified random number generators (RNG) are used by reputable online casinos to mimic the randomness of a physical roulette wheel. The true thrill of roulette lies in this unpredictability, which draws players in and keeps them engaged.

The house edge in roulette represents a significant reason why the game has endured despite technological changes. In traditional European roulette, the house edge is roughly 2.7%, while American roulette has a higher edge of approximately 5.26% due to the additional double zero. This consistent edge provides stability, keeping the underlying structure of the game intact regardless of whether you are playing in a lavish casino or online at home. Another vital point to consider is the aspect of player experience. Online casinos strive to replicate the atmosphere of physical casinos. Many operators utilize impressive graphics, immersive soundscapes, and engaging gameplay features while maintaining the original format of the game itself. Live dealer roulette, for instance, bridges the gap between digital and in-person experiences, as players can interact with real croupiers in real time through streaming technologies. This enhancement does not alter the game; it simply enriches the experience.
